2006 BMW 323 vs. 1979 BMW 633
To start off, 2006 BMW 323 is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 BMW 633.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 BMW 633 would be higher. At 3,210 cc (6 cylinders), 1979 BMW 633 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1979 BMW 633 (194 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 2006 BMW 323. (175 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1979 BMW 633 should accelerate faster than 2006 BMW 323.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1979 BMW 633 (285 Nm) has 55 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 BMW 323. (230 Nm). This means 1979 BMW 633 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 BMW 323.
